When the Queen of Pentacles Reversed and the Wheel of Fortune tarot cards combine, they create a powerful message about the cyclical nature of life and the need to embrace change.

The Queen of Pentacles Reversed suggests a lack of stability and overindulgence, while the Wheel of Fortune represents the ups and downs of life’s fortunes.

Together, they caution against becoming too attached to material possessions and the need to cultivate a flexible and adaptable mindset to navigate life’s inevitable twists and turns.

The Meaning of Queen Of Pentacles Reversed and Wheel Of Fortune Tarot Cards Combination in Career and Finances

queen of pentacles reversed

The Queen of Pentacles reversed represents a lack of financial stability and self-care.

This card suggests that you may be neglecting your finances or failing to establish a solid financial foundation.

In career, it can indicate a lack of organization or focus, which may lead to setbacks or missed opportunities.

Paired with the Wheel of Fortune, this combination suggests that there may be unexpected changes or events that will affect your finances and career.

The Wheel of Fortune represents the cyclical nature of life and the inevitability of change.

For example, this combination may indicate a sudden change in job or income, which can be either positive or negative depending on how you handle it.

It can also suggest the need to be adaptable and open to new opportunities.

However, if you have neglected your finances or career, this combination may bring negative consequences.

On the whole, the Queen of Pentacles reversed and Wheel of Fortune combination suggests that you need to be proactive in taking care of your finances and career, and be prepared for unexpected changes that may come your way.

Queen Of Pentacles Reversed Combined With Wheel Of Fortune Tarot Card: Meaning in Love and Relationships

wheel of fortune

When the Queen of Pentacles is reversed and combined with the Wheel of Fortune tarot card in a love reading, it can indicate a significant shift in the relationship’s energy.

This combination can suggest a time of instability and unpredictability, where the couple is struggling to find balance and harmony.

Practical and insightful points to consider when receiving this combination in a love reading include:

  1. Financial Instability: The Queen of Pentacles reversed may indicate financial instability or a lack of financial support in the relationship.

    This could lead to stress and strain in the partnership.

  2. Selfishness: The reversed Queen of Pentacles may suggest a partner who is selfish or overly focused on their own needs, neglecting their partner’s emotional needs.

  3. Unpredictability: The Wheel of Fortune symbolizes change and unpredictability.

    This combination may suggest a time of ups and downs in the relationship, where it is challenging to predict what will happen next.

  4. Lack of Communication: The Queen of Pentacles reversed can indicate a lack of communication in the relationship.

    This may lead to misunderstandings and conflicts.

  5. Need for Adaptability: The Wheel of Fortune suggests that adaptability is necessary in the relationship.

    Both partners need to be willing to change and grow together to overcome challenges.

All in all, the Queen of Pentacles reversed combined with the Wheel of Fortune tarot card in a love reading can indicate a time of instability and unpredictability.

It is essential to communicate openly and be adaptable to overcome challenges and build a stronger partnership.

Description and Symbolism of Wheel Of Fortune Tarot Card:

The Wheel of Fortune is one of the most recognizable tarot cards, depicting a large wheel with various creatures and symbols around it.

The wheel is usually divided into four sections, with each section representing one of the four elements – earth, air, fire, and water.

The wheel is also surrounded by a serpent or a sphinx, representing the eternal cycles of life and death.

The Wheel of Fortune card symbolizes the cyclical nature of life and the constant changes that occur.

The wheel is always turning, and what goes up must come down.

This card represents the ups and downs of life, the ebb and flow of energy, and the unpredictability of fate.

The creatures on the wheel, such as the angel, the eagle, the lion, and the bull, represent different aspects of life, such as strength, courage, and spiritual growth.

In readings, the Wheel of Fortune can indicate a change in fortune or circumstances, either positive or negative.

It can also represent a turning point in a person’s life, a time when they must make an important decision or take a new direction.

The card encourages the individual to stay flexible and adaptable to change, to embrace the journey of life with openness and acceptance.

TL;DR, the Wheel of Fortune is a powerful symbol of life’s ever-changing nature and the importance of staying grounded, centered, and open-minded in the face of whatever comes our way.
